The World Group Play-offs were the main play-offs of 2010 Davis Cup. Winners advanced to the World Group, and loser were relegated in the Zonal Regions I.

Results

  •  Belgium,  Germany,  India,  Sweden and  United States will remain in the World Group in 2011.
  •  Austria,  Kazakhstan and  Romania are promoted to the World Group in 2011.
  •  Australia,  Brazil,  Colombia,  Italy and  South Africa will remain in Zonal Group I in 2011.
  •  Ecuador,  Israel and   Switzerland are relegated to Zonal Group I in 2011.
  • Australia vs. Belgium

    Rain stopped play on the third day: only 51 minutes of play were held in rubber 4 in which Peter Luczak and Olivier Rochus won 4 games each in the first set. The remainder of Rubber 4 and Rubber 5 continued on 20 September 2010.
